
J-14 is scouting out the hottest bands around... and this week's pick is Sleeping with Sirens.
Here are five things you need to know about Sleeping with Sirens whose acoustic album 'If You Were A Movie, This Would Be Your Soundtrack' is out tomorrow!
1. Formed back in 2009, Grand Rapids, Michigan's Sleeping with Sirens consists of vocalist Kellin Quinn, guitarists Jesse Lawson and Jack Fowler, drummer Gabe Barham, and bassist Justin Hills. How have they evolved throughout the years? "I would say we just started playing the music we wanted to play and stopped worrying about what everyone else thought," Kellin tells J-14. "We try and mature with each album and let our music speak for it self."
2. The rock band pulls influences from a range of sounds including the Foo Fighters, Incubus, Ryan Adams, Jay-Z, and The Black Keys.
3. With two full-length albums under their belt, tomorrow their acoustic third album, 'If You Were A Movie, This Would Be Your Soundtrack', will be released. "We did the acoustic album for our fans. There were so many acoustic videos floating around YouTube and we wanted to give kids something to listen to while they were winding down at night," Kellin says. "We have the in your face heavy side and a softer side. We like to show both."

"The song is about fake friends and lies, over coming and living with the idea that all that matters is what 'you' make of your life," Kellin says. "Everyone else is secondary."
5. 2012 is sure to be a busy year for Sleeping with Sirens while they continue to work on new music and tour across the U.S. this summer on the Vans Warped Tour. "[We're most looking forward to] hanging out with all our friends, and playing to new audiences," Kellin tells J-14 about their Warped plans.
